The Arnprior Figure Skating Club began as a recreation program in 1967 under the direction of Bert Hall. The Arnprior Skating Club formed in 1974 and performed various shows & carnivals at the skating rink located on Elgin Street in Arnprior. The club moved over to the new Civic Centre when it was built in 1978 and members performed at the official opening on September 13, 1978 when Toller Cranston was the star of the show. Former Presidents of the AFSC were Beth McOrmand (1970 - 1974), Allan Hall (1974 - 1975), Russ Havelin (1975 - 1976), Louis McCready (1976 - 1978), Janet Crone (1978 - 1979), Bob Parsons (1979 - 1980), Alexandra Radlein (1980 - 1981), Brenda Ranson (1981 - 1982), Isobel McEwan (1982 - 1983), Maurice Gallant (1983 - 1984).
Acquisition Source
Donated by Mrs. Isobel McEwan, past-president of the Arnprior Figure Skating Club and Mrs. Brenda Ranson in 2007.
Scope and Content
Fonds consists of newspaper clippings and programs of the Arnprior Figure Skating Club from 1974 - 2002. As the McEwan family was heavily involved with both figure skating and the Arnprior Junior 'B' Packers, the fonds also includes a 1992 - 1993 packers program and newspaper clippings. Also included is a poster and clippings about a special celebration, "McEwan Family Night" at the season opener Friday, September 27, 1996.
